[tex] \frac{2x}{3} - \frac{5}{6} = \frac{-5x}{12} + \frac{1}{4} [/tex]
<< Equate all the denominators with a ^minimum^ common number(12).
[tex]= \frac{4.2x}{12} - \frac{5.2}{12} = \frac{-5x}{12} + \frac{3}{12} [/tex]
<< Classify same terms to one side. The fraction that you threw to other side in the equation changes.
[tex]= \frac{8x+5x}{12} = \frac{3+10}{12} [/tex]
[tex] \frac{13x}{12} \frac{13x}{12} [/tex]
13x=13
x=13/13
x=1
So the main equation's solution set is 1.
